
Lower Saxony Wadden Sea National Park: planning guide
Vast UNESCO Wadden Sea flats and islands off Lower Saxony’s North Sea coast.
Lower Saxony Wadden Sea National Park is in Lower Saxony, Germany. The nearest town is Nordseeheilbad Wangerooge — roughly 10.6 km (6.6 mi) out, about 18 min of driving.
